More in-depth treatments include Ultraviolet and Visible Spectroscopy (second edition) by Michael Thomas, Wiley, Chichester, 1997. This book was written as part of a distance-learning course within the Analytical Chemistry by Open Learning (ACOL) series, so it contains a good number of examples and sample questions. Its typical ACOL format will probably annoy some readers. [Pg.558]

Studies of a number of first-year project-based learning courses with engineering content have shown that courses with professional practice inaease student self-efficacy. One of the studies has specifically shown that students with higher self-efficacy for the performance of engineering tasks are more likely to select an engineering major and persist in engineering over time. [Pg.227]
